Loyola Water Polo sets up for a big weekend of competition in NorCal, with the Cubs (10-5) heading to the 2022 North/South Challenge in Atherton, CA. Loyola last won the prestigious event back in 2019, defeating rival Harvard-Westlake in the finals. The Cubs take the No. 7 seed into this year’s tournament.
Loyola will open up on Friday (Oct. 14) against No. 10 seed Miramonte at 2:50PM at Sacred Heart Prep in Atherton. Should the Cubs win, they advance to face the winner of No. 2 Mater Dei/No. 10 Jesuit at 7:30PM later that night. A loss to Miramonte moves Loyola into the 6:50PM game at Gunn HS in Palo Alto.
